My company has desided to put our customers in our LDAP (Active Directory)
in there own ou. They have also desided that our intranet and extranet shall
be the same pages where buttons shall be visible depending on the users
rights. They have desided that employees and extranet-users shall be in
different ou:s in the ldap.

So far there are no problem. The problem is that it is decided that our
customers shall login with their email-adress and employees shall use our
usual login-name (sAMAccountName).

We are using tomcats jndi-realm witch by the documentation supports
searching in several userbases.

The question, can I have two arguments in userSearch as with useBase to be
able to handle this situation or do I have to force my management to rethink
this? What is the syntax for this if it works?

is there a way to define multiple realms for one context?

Example:
I want http://myserver:8080/cocoon/admin to use tomcat-users.xml as 
realm whereas http://myserver:8080/cocoon/otherdir should use a 
database.

The reason for this is that I do not want people with write access to 
the user table to create admin users themselves.
